Number of open full-function database data sets
IMS does not enforce a limit on the number of full-function database data sets that can be open at the same time by multiple databases. However, the resources available at your installation and the consumption of those resources by both your IMS configuration and the other z/OS® subsystems that your installation might be running, such as Db2 for z/OS, could potentially limit the number of data sets that you can open.
For full-function databases, one of the resources that could become constrained with a large number of open data sets is the private storage of the DL/I separate address space (DLISAS), which requires storage both above and below the 16 MB line.
